giraffes with short necks ate all the small trees. Giraffes with long necks were able to eat the short trees and the bigger trees. So when the smaller trees were finished the smaller giraffes died out and the taller giraffes passed the trait for having alonger necks along.

Positives -
- There becomes a higher consumption of certain foods and drinks (a boom-time for ice-cream and cold drinks)
- Domestic tourism is having a boon with "stay-cations"
- Measured industrial output rises, hence GDP rises, because of increased use of electricity
Negatives -
- Heatwaves can cause a surge of dry weather. This could lead to Droughts and could have a negative impact on locals. Crops for farmers could dry out, and there could become a lack of vegetation (for animals too).
- Higher death rate for people with certain conditions (e.g. more heart attacks, especially among-st elderly people)
- Reduced numbers for certain forms of entertainment (ie cinema etc)

There are different criteria that could be used to classify rocks that are igneous. These are:
1) Minerals Available in Rock: The minerals in a rock and their relative proportions in the rock mainly rely on the magma's chemical composition.
2) The Rock's texture: Rock texture largely relies on the magma's cooling history. Thus rocks with the same chemical composition and presence of the same minerals could have very distinct textures.
3) Color: A rock's color relies on the minerals and the size of the grain. Generally speaking, rocks containing lots of feldspar and quartz are light colored, and rocks containing lots of pyroxenes, olivines and amphiboles (minerals of ferromagnesium) are dark colored. But when applied to rocks of the same structure but distinct grain size, color can be misleading.
4) Chemical composition: The most distinctive characteristic is the chemical composition of igneous rocks. The structure generally represents the magma's structure, thus providing data about the rock's source.
